Ошибка слияния манифеста, minSdkVersion 1 не может быть меньше версии 4, объявленной в библиотеке - PullRequest
0 голосов
/ 25 февраля 2019

Я пытаюсь запустить приложение Android, которое было сгенерировано с помощью Ionic, но я получил сообщение об ошибке:

Ошибка слияния манифеста: использует-sdk: minSdkVersion 1 не может быть меньше, чем объявленная версия 4в библиотеке [com.commit451: PhotoView: 1.2.4] /Users/gediminassukys/.gradle/caches/transforms-1/files-1.1/PhotoView-1.2.4.aar/ffdb107897f674c9e99efaa7549d295e/AndroidManifest.xml, так как библиотека может использоватьAPI недоступны в 1 Предложение: используйте совместимую библиотеку с minSdk не более 1, или увеличьте версию minSdk этого проекта по крайней мере до 4, или используйте инструменты: overrideLibrary = "uk.co.senab.photoview" для принудительного использования (можетпривести к сбоям во время выполнения)

Android Studio после этой ошибки предложите мне следующее:

Предложение: используйте совместимую библиотеку с minSdk не более 1 или увеличьте этот проектверсия minSdk как минимум до 4 или используйте инструменты: overrideLibrary = "uk.co.senab.photoview" для принудительного использования (может привести к сбоям во время выполнения)

1 Ответ

0 голосов
/ 25 февраля 2019

Чтобы использовать данную библиотеку, вы должны установить минимальную поддерживаемую версию SDK равную 4.defaultMinSdkVersion=4, это решит проблему, с которой вы столкнулись.

...